A lot will depend on your instructor. Early in my pregnancy I had a fantastic yoga teacher who was great at 'body work' so I got a lot of stretching and relaxation. Unfortunately she had to quit teaching. Late in my pregnancy I went to Pure Yoga. The instructor was very into breathing, which I didn't have a lot of patience for. She did teach us some positions which were good for relieving lower back ache, improving circulation and dealing with swelling feet. I did get a bit bored with all the breathing though and wanted my previous teach back! Overall, if the yoga teacher is qualified to teach pregnant mums, yoga is a good thing to do, for stretching and suppleness esp when you have a big tummy and balance is a bit off. I swam a lot too, almost daily towards the end of my pregnancy, and this was really the best thing.
